Which Manual Tranny for a 383 Stroker

I have a 1982 Camaro and I am going to build up a 383 stroker engine with about 500hp & tq give or take. I want to put in a manual tranny, just not sure which one to get. An aftermarket Richmond T-56, a Tremec TKO, etc. Which one will hold up with the application that I am running. Any help would be greatly appreciated.

I would not recommend the richmond T56 because its 1.9" longer than a borg warner T56 which requires the driveshaft and torque arm shortened. Also, I have heard that the speedo cable does not clear the trans tunnel due to the extra length. I would get a T56 from a 94-97 F-body because tis rated at 450 ft/lbs of torque, it will re use your existing driveshaft and torque arm, the only problem is you need a custom cross member, but Skulte sells that piece for $150. There is also a tech article on their website on how to do this. The only other trans I would recommend would be a Muncie M21 or M22 or a Borg Warner Super T10, but they would take a little more work to make fit.

P.S. You could also use a 93 F-body t56 which is still bolt in, but due to a weaker casing it is only rated at 400 ft/lbs.
